Multipass MCP Server

A Model Context Protocol (MCP) server to manage Multipass instances.

Usage

Claude Desktop Configuration

Add via the command line:

claude mcp add --transport stdio multipass -- uvx multipass-mcp

Or add the following to your Claude configuration:

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"multipass": {
      "command": "uvx",
      "args": ["multipass-mcp"]
    }
  }
}

Available Tools

The server currently provides comprehensive support for all core Multipass CLI commands, categorized as follows:

Instance Management

  • list_instances: List all instances with their current state and IP addresses.
  • launch_instance: Create a new instance with optional CPU, memory, and disk specs.
  • start_instance: Start a stopped instance.
  • stop_instance: Stop a running instance.
  • restart_instance: Restart running instances.
  • suspend_instance: Suspend a running instance (saves state to disk).
  • resume_instance: Resume a suspended instance.
  • delete_instance: Delete an instance (with optional immediate purge).
  • purge_instances: Cleanup all deleted instances permanently.
  • recover_instance: Recover previously deleted instances.
  • clone_instance: Create an exact copy of an existing instance.
  • execute_command: Run shell commands inside an instance.
  • get_instance_info: Get detailed specifications and resource usage (CPU, Memory, Disk).

Snapshots

  • list_snapshots: List all available snapshots across instances.
  • get_snapshot_info: Get detailed information about a specific snapshot.
  • snapshot_instance: Take a new snapshot of an instance.
  • restore_instance: Restore an instance from a previously taken snapshot.

Storage & Files

  • mount_directory: Mount a local host directory inside an instance.
  • umount_directory: Unmount a previously mounted directory.
  • transfer_file: Transfer files or directories between the host and instances.

Aliases

  • create_alias: Create an alias to run a specific command on an instance directly from the host.
  • list_aliases: List all configured aliases in the current context.
  • remove_alias: Remove one or more existing aliases.
  • switch_alias_context: Switch to or create a new alias context.

System, Network & Config

  • find_images: Find available images for launching new instances.
  • list_networks: List host network devices available for instance bridging.
  • get_config: Get global Multipass configuration settings.
  • set_config: Set global Multipass configuration settings.
  • get_version: Display version information for the Multipass client and daemon.
  • authenticate: Authenticate with the Multipass service using a passphrase.
